@batichi A few weeks ago I was talking to someone on discord about the need for some folks to switch to Linux once Windows 12 rolls around. He's a Linux user and preacher but even he admitted that the problem with Linux is that it's not friendly to artists (or basically, normal people) because the folks behind it made it for similarly-minded people, not for everyone outside of it.

He said (paraphrased) it would be great if more artists would use Linux, so that way the field could have more people with a "programmer and artist brain" and make Linux better. But he knows it's hard for that to happen.

(whines) when I see an interesting anthology open for submissions and they not only want a pitch, but a completed comic already to submit and try to get accepted... :zerotwo:

I've done that a couple of times, which is how I have some shorts in the first place. But I don't have the energy or time to do that anymore, especially when it's a coin toss on whether I get accepted or not. I always get rejected, so not only did I do extra work but I don't get paid (as being accepted means """""possibly"""" getting paid.)

And as someone getting increasingly more desperate for a paying job, I really don't want to do "free" work for anthologies anymore...
